Chargers QB Justin Herbert's new haircut sends social media into frenzy

Justin Herbert's luscious locks are gone. 

The Los Angeles Chargers quarterback showed up to the team facility on Wednesday looking a little different with a fresh haircut. It's safe to say the internet had a fun time discussing his new hairdo. 

One person even compared him to a young Anakin Skywalker. Another compared him to Scut Farkus from the 1983 film "A Christmas Story." 

Here are some other hilarious reactions to his haircut:

Herbert, who is 1-7 in his rookie campaign with the Chargers, appears to be shaking things up. Maybe it's an effort to try and turn things around this weekend, or maybe he just simply wanted to change his look. 

Whatever the case may be, it certainly made for a great Wednesday on social media.
